Dog Fatally Wounded In East Hollywood Officer-Involved Shooting

LOS ANGELES (CBSLA.com) —  Authorities said a dog was shot and killed by police in East Hollywood Friday morning.

Officers responded to an assault with a deadly weapon call about 11:10 a.m. in the 1500 block of N. Serrano Avenue.

When officers arrived on scene, they were allegedly told the family dog was secure, said Nuria Vanegas with the LAPD's Media Relations Section.

She said, however, that the Pit Bull/Labrador mix got loose and charged officers, prompting at least one of them to open fire.

No officers were hurt.

A suspect was arrested at the scene on suspicion of making criminal threats, according to the LAPD.
